Local Spotlight: Cristian David Lince Aux

Cristian David Lince Aux

Age: 30

Occupation: Juice maker

Place of birth: Bogotá, Colombia

Q. When did you move to Routt County, and what brought you here?

A. Nine years ago. Travel, work, exchange.

Q. What's the biggest risk you've taken recently?

A. Nothing is a risk because everything happens for a reason.

Q. Has a book ever changed your life? What was it and why?

A. "The Power of Now," because it helps you to realize the illusion of time.

Q. What's the best piece of advice you've ever been given?

A. Smile to life.

Q. What three things would you want people to know about you?

A. Juice, Colombian, music.

Q. What did you want to be when you grew up?

A. Healthy and happy.

Q. If you could invite any four people to dinner, who would they be and what would you talk about?

A. Mama Hasinto (Kogi Indian), Jesus, Dalai Lama and you. The truth, love and peace.

Q. Do you collect anything?

A. I collect everything.

Q. What was your first job?

A. Sales in my mom's clothing store in Colombia.

Q. Do you have a tattoo? If so, what of and why did you choose it?

A. Yes, a hand with an eye in it (premonition).

Q. Do you have any phobias?

A. Not being able to breathe.

Q. If you could go back in time, to what event or time period would you go?

A. 0 to 11 (1979 to 1990), my childhood age.

Q. What is your favorite thing to do in Routt County?

A. Rippin' the hills of Mount Werner.

Favorites

Book: The Bible

Song: "Somewhere Over the Rainbow"

Color: Blue, green

Food: Asian

Sport to watch: Soccer

Vacation spot: Wherever I am
